Village District
The primary purpose of the Village classification is to strengthen the unique sense of place of the traditional Village of New Danville, which is important component to the Township’s history and heritage; and to recognize and promote the continuation of the Village’s distinct identity as a traditional, compact, rural-mixed use development pattern and uses centered around the intersection Millersville Road SR 0741/ Marticville Road SR 0324 and New Danville Pike SR 0324/SR 3022. Lands within the Village have traditionally been developed as a compatible mixture of lower density residential uses along with a limited amount of supporting, small-scale commercial, institutional, and public uses. The Village is intended to accommodate only a very limited amount of new development, primarily via reuse of existing residential buildings and properties for a compatible mixture of residential and nonresidential uses. Additionally, it is intended to exclude such uses and development that are not compatible with existing development pattern and uses. Since the Village is not designated as a growth area it is not likely to be served by public sewer service or public water service within the foreseeable future; therefore larger lot sizes are indicated.
